Building the network of people and open-source sports data packages to foster more diversity and inclusion within sports analytics. Contact @saiemgilani for Q's
🔧 Under the hood:
• httr → httr2 backend
• usethis → cli messaging
• Crash-on-error fix across 147 wrapper functions
• furrr/future moved to Suggests — leaner installs
Thank you to all who raised issues!
Full changelog: https://t.co/UrxWiLankB
🏀 hoopR v3.0.0 is out now!
The biggest release yet for R's men's basketball data package — NBA Stats API, ESPN & G-League, all in one place.
install.packages("hoopR")
https://t.co/Xw3BVwh1lH
h/t: @SaiemGilani, @akeaswaran#rstats#nba#sportsdataverse
🆕 What's new in v3.0.0:
• nba_pbp() now defaults to V3 — richer shot coords, distance & result
• nba_boxscoresummaryv3()
• nba_dunkscoreleaders(), nba_gravityleaders(), nba_iststandings()
• espn_nba/mbb_team_current_roster(), nbagl_live_pbp/box score()
Headed up to Boston this weekend for the 20th MIT Sloan Sports Analytics Conference.
Twenty years. Still one of the best weekends on the calendar.
I caught up with friends and former colleagues scattered across teams and league offices. Finally met in person with some folks I've done consulting work for, always hits different when you can shake hands. Had real conversations about university partnerships and team collaborations that I'm genuinely excited about. Met with instructors who teach on our platform. Talked shop with professors whose opinions our team takes seriously, making sure we're building with actual academic rigor, not just marketing it.
But the highlight for me? I was invited by the National High School Sports Analytics Association to run an interactive session on building sports analytics apps with AI. I had some big names to follow on that agenda, people I've looked up to in this space for years, and I don't take that lightly.
What stuck with me most was meeting the students. Sharp. Curious. Already building things. The future of this field is in good hands.
My message to them was simple:
Build.
Build a model. Build an app. Write about it. Teach it to someone else. You never know who's paying attention. One project, one post, one thing you put out into the world, that's how opportunities find you. That's how conversations start. Careers in this space aren't built on credentials alone. They're built on proof that you can do the work.
Anyone can copy code now with AI. The analysts who get hired are the ones who can explain the decisions behind it, storytell with data, and interact with stakeholders.
And if you're teaching this stuff (at any level) I'll say what I always say: craft end-to-end projects that students actually care about. Not toy datasets. Not disconnected exercises. Real questions, real data, real outputs they can point to and say "I built that and I can tell you why it works."
There's never been a better time to get your hands dirty. The tools are accessible. The data is out there. The only thing stopping most people is starting.
Twenty years of Sloan. Still learning. Still building.
#ssac #rstats #python #sportsanalytics #stemeducation
Excited to announce: I'm leading K-12 programs at @Athlyticz!
They're using sports data to teach real data science skills—cloud environments, end-to-end workflows, enterprise tools.
Sports is the hook. Skills are universal.
Join the waitlist: https://t.co/1DyhPmBBdL
Today is one of those full-circle moments.
I took this photo last night in the Iowa State Statistics building, Snedecor Hall.
A few feet in front of me is the room where I defended my PhD thesis.
Directly to my right is the room where I took my first graduate R course in 2013 in the early days of RStudio.
And for the past decade, I’ve returned to Ames often… my in-laws live here, and this campus has become a second home.
It felt fitting to make this announcement here:
AthlyticZ and Posit PBC are officially entering into a full partnership.
This spring, AthlyticZ will become the first learning platform to offer Posit Workbench and Positron directly inside an LMS for creators, instructors, and students.
Fully integrated. Scalable. And built for modern, reproducible data science education.
This is a defining moment for us.
We’ve spent the last 18 months building AthlyticZ with the belief that data science education deserves better than conventional e-learning practices. And that belief comes from the teams and people around me:
To our development teams and instructors, none of this happens without you. You’ve demonstrated over and over that AthlyticZ can push far beyond the standard models of online education by building products and content with true depth, rigor, and creativity.
Our MVP site is only the beginning.
The talent inside this group is the reason we were able to present a credible and ambitious vision to Posit, and the reason they believed we could deliver it.
To the Posit team
A huge thank-you to Connor Casey, Jason Milnes, and Andrea Tharp for guiding this partnership through the last two months. Submitting a plan that sits outside the typical scope of a company as established as Posit was intimidating, but your thoughtful questions, fairness, and clarity helped shape something better than what I started with.
And thank you to Posit’s C-Suite for trusting the vision that Connor and the team brought forward. We’re committed to building learning products that raise the bar for data science training at scale, from creator-driven workflows to fully integrated cohort experiences powered by Workbench and Positron.
And a special thank-you to Libby Heeren. Your introduction set all of this in motion. I can’t thank you enough.
This partnership marks the start of a new chapter, not just for AthlyticZ, but for anyone who wants to learn or teach data science in a way that reflects the actual practice of the field.
Onward.
— Michael Czahor —
Founder, AthlyticZ #rstats #datascience #python #edtech
Episode 40 is out now! Joined by the legend and innovator in the analytics industry @SaiemGilani founder of @gameonpaper and @sportsdataverse . Click the link below for a great convo on the importance of community, trends in college football and how nerds rule the sport. ⬇️
Mission: Learn about what separates Athlyticz from other platforms - we are more than just course offerings - we are a fully-scaled LMS, custom-built for enterprise training.
https://t.co/qesnbwWnle
It's back! The annual Ohio State Sports Analytics Conference will be March 28 - March 29.
Join us for two days of insights from 14 expert speakers, SSI's student research fair and an action-packed Hackathon.
Interested? Visit this link:
https://t.co/6gAiwWox7E
🚀Exciting Opportunity for Presenters at Sloan & SABR Analytics Conferences!🚀
Are you presenting at the Sloan Sports Analytics Conference (March 7-8) or the SABR Analytics Conference (March 14-16)? We're offering a unique chance to enhance your presentation with AthlyticZ!
Selected presenters will work directly with our development team to create an immersive audience experience through our interactive LMS. Imagine running models, apps, and real-time analytics during your talk, all in a way that connects you directly to your audience.
Applications are open until December 1st, 2024 – don’t miss this chance to elevate your presentation!
Apply today and collaborate with Athlyticz to make your presentation unforgettable!
Our team will cover ALL development work and cloud fees for those who are selected.
https://t.co/DBl4PrIG4Z
We’re looking forward to partnering with top presenters to bring your data science and analytics ideas to life in a whole new way.
@SloanSportsConf@sabr@scott_bush
✨Are you looking to upskill and take your Shiny apps to the next level?
Sign up : https://t.co/JqcUojSck6
Whether you’re new to Shiny or a seasoned pro, our Shiny Ignite (for beginners) and Shiny Elevate (for advanced developers) programs are designed to guide you through the entire process of building and optimizing your Shiny applications.
But that's not all – our brand new Athlyticz + (A+) programs offer full access to the Athlyticz Academy Learning Platform, where you’ll have your very own virtual machine environment with all the tools you need to succeed:
📚Pre-installed libraries, coding scripts, and data sources – everything is set up and ready for you to dive into.
💻Weekly tasks, coding assignments, quizzes, and interactive case studies delivered directly to your learning dashboard.
No matter your field, our program is for you!
Shiny apps are becoming essential in fields like finance, engineering, medicine, sports, and more. If you’re ready to productionize your apps and optimize performance, you won’t want to miss this opportunity! - All with the support of a world-class team of top Shiny developers from around the globe.
Here's what you can expect:
Shiny Ignite: Spark Your Shiny Interest 🔥
Fundamentals of Shiny: building visualizations, creating dashboards, and deploying apps.
Step-by-step coding sessions on reactivity, input/output elements, and UI customizations.
Beginner-friendly competitions to apply your skills.
Shiny Elevate: Raise Your Shiny Skills to the Next Level 🚀
Advanced case studies on large-scale applications, performance optimization, and advanced UI/UX.
Modular workflows, app security, and tuning covered in hands-on coding sessions.
Competitions to push your skills and build professional-grade applications.
Why Join Us?
Applicable to All Disciplines: Whether you're in finance, medicine, sports, engineering, or another field, our programs are designed to help you enhance your Shiny expertise.
Hands-on Learning: Your learning is practical and real-world, with coding assignments, projects, and weekly tasks tailored to your level.
Virtual Machine Environment: You’ll have everything you need on our state-of-the-art virtual machines hosted through our platform.
Interested? Preregister to secure a risk free month at launch!
Sign up to stay updated and be the first to know when we launch. Preregistration spots are limited, so don’t miss out on this opportunity to transform your Shiny skills!
Looking forward to seeing what you’ll create!
Athlyticz Team
Sign up : https://t.co/JqcUojSck6
#rstats #rshiny #rprogramming #shiny